The Institute for Adult Spiritual Renewal
Important Information
Each week begins with check-in from 1:00 p.m. to 4:00 p.m. followed by orientation at 5:00 p.m. At this time you will have an opportunity to meet the faculty for the week, along with participants and Institute staff. Immediately following orientations participants are invited to a picnic dinner at 6:00 p.m. Commuters planning to attend the picnic should make payment arrangements prior to the picnic social.
CLASS FORMAT - Morning courses are generally offered in two hour segments Monday through Friday from 8:30 to 10:30 a.m.* Afternoon sessions are Monday through Thursday from 1:30 to 4:00 p.m. Evening courses are Monday through Thursday from 6:00 to 8:30 p.m. Weekend courses will take place Friday afternoon, 3:00 to 6:00 p.m. and all day Saturday, 9:00 to 5:00 p.m. Each course includes a total of 10 hours. *Since the 4th of July falls on a Friday this year, week one will hold class Monday through Thursday from 8:30 to 11:00 a.m.
MEALS - For participants residing on campus all meals are included in the overall package. Each Monday evening we will enjoy a community picnic included in the basic package.
PRAYER/WORSHIP - Special prayer experiences will be offered for Institute participants twice each week. Theresa Donohoo and Rory Cooney will provide music at our liturgies. Other opportunities for prayer and worship may be found on campus.
WEATHER - Loyola is directly on the shore of Lake Michigan sometimes providing pleasant, cool breezes. All facilities are air conditioned so you may want to bring a sweater or light jacket. Typically, June and July are quite pleasant.
FURTHER INFORMATION - You will receive confirmation promptly after receipt of your registration. Make sure you indicate a second choice for courses should there be any cancellations.

Receive Graduate Credit through the Institute of Pastoral Studies at Loyola University Chicago
The following combinations may be completed to obtain three graduate credits offered through the Institute of Pastoral Studies at Loyola University Chicago, in conjunction with the IASR. In addition to attending the courses an integration paper will be required. Other courses may be taken for one graduate credit by students enrolled through IPS Loyola (also requiring a smaller integration paper).
1. Prayer and the New Creation Story: #130, #230, #330
2. Contemporary Psychology and Spirituality: #140, #111, #213
3. Issues in Spiritual Direction: #112, #122, #210
4. Spirituality of Hope: #211, #240, #311
5. Contemporary Mystics and Prophets: # 212, #222, 321
6. Scripture Studies*: #110, #120, #312, #323
*Select three out of the four offered
